This vintage linen postcard features a picturesque view of the Community Church located in Boulder Junction, Wisconsin. The image captures the charming rustic architecture of the church, surrounded by lush pine trees under a bright blue sky dotted with fluffy clouds. The building's distinctive stone and wood construction speaks to the quaint, small-town charm of this northern Wisconsin locale. Printed using linen postcard technology, popular from the 1930s through the 1950s, this postcard boasts vibrant colors and a slightly textured surface that enhances the scenic detail. The card is an original production published by Wyman Post Card Co. of Wausau, Wisconsin, and includes photography credit to Guy A. Wyman.
